Deep dive

More detail on how we serve Rock Hill, NY

Every parking lot in Rock Hill, NY has specific drainage. We note how refreeze forms on your site and modify routes to fit. That history lives with your account so new drivers follow it.

Loading docks turn slick without attention. Our loader crews scarify compacted snow before salting to prevent sheet ice. Bumpers get shielded so freight keeps moving.

Courtyards see steady foot traffic. We color-tag primary loops, staff sidewalk crews, and re-walk after visiting hours. Handrails receive detail passes to keep people sure-footed.

Fleet matching prevents noise. Dense plazas get compact plows while wide lots get wings. Intentional allocation keeps neighbors happy.

Rock Hill is a hamlet (and census-designated place) in Sullivan County, New York, United States. At the 2020 census the population was 2,369.
